Type of housing: On campus
Arranged by: Host university
If returning, I would choose: Apartment/House
Why? The campus is far away from everything. Brest is a very dynamic city where people are really nice, so i would have preferred to have more contact with this people.
Personal comments:
Life at campus is not bad... We have a bar that any student can open whenever he wants, and there are a lot of parties. But life in Brest is better.

Type of housing: On campus
Arranged by: Host university
If returning, I would choose:
Why?
Personal comments:
The housing is located on the campus, and it is really comfortable because you can wake up just 5 minutes before the class starts ;) Each room is equiped with a telephone and also an RJ45 wall-mounted jack, so you can have an internet connection 24h/7! Only €10/year to subscribe for the internet connection. Once you're connected to the network, you can start downloading many movies from the intranet servers. Nice, huh! The only drawback is that the housing/the school is really far from down town! The public bus only passes 2 times/hour, so it's a bit uncomfortable if you want to go to the downtown.
